Restoring Function and Strength: Hijama Cupping for Stroke Rehabilitation
Stroke survivors often struggle significant challenges in regaining movement, ability, and coordination. Traditional rehabilitation methods can be helpful, but some individuals explore alternative therapies to support their recovery journey. Hijama cupping, a traditional practice involving suction cups placed on specific points of the body, has been gaining attention as a potential therapy in stroke rehabilitation. Proponents suggest that Hijama cupping can help website improve blood circulation, reduce inflammation, and promote muscle restoration, ultimately contributing to functional improvement and strength development.
- Additionally, some individuals report a sense of well-being following Hijama cupping sessions, which may contribute to their overall commitment to rehabilitation.
- Nonetheless, it is important to note that research on the effectiveness of Hijama cupping for stroke rehabilitation is still ongoing. More rigorous studies are needed to validate its efficacy and safety.
Individuals considering Hijama cupping as part of their stroke rehabilitation should discuss their healthcare provider to determine if it is an appropriate option for them. It's essential to work with a qualified practitioner who has experience in treating stroke patients and to follow all safety provided.
